^ This. The Firing order is key to the difference between the two. It sounds different from the LsX series of engines (1-8-7-2-6-5-4-3) due to the Coyote 5.0's different firing order (1-5-4-8-6-3-7-2). Other variables also come into play, such as heads (2 valve vs. 4valve), cam (single vs. quad), exhaust, bore, stroke, compression, etc... just like the others mentioned.

On the new ones the sound inside is a different story..


See that small tube coming off the intake pipe? That has a resonator ("speaker") in it and it's piped thru the firewall next to the brake pedal.

It creates a low growling engine sound that to the driver, seems to be coming thru the firewall. There's a little piece of foam in the mouth of the pipe that if you take it out, it changes the sound to a more hollow intake sound due to the resonance of the flex tube.
